导言:
本文面向希望在IM钱包中充值USDT并支持比特现金(BCH)的用户与运营者,系统说明合约支持要求、典型交易流程、比特现金支持要点、如何实现高效资金管理与处理、加密存储实践,以及对行业未来的预测与建议。文中包含操作要点与风险提示,建议实际操作前先在小金额上测试。
一、合约支持(多链与合约兼容)
1. 多链背景:USDT存在于多条链上(常见:ERC‑20(以太坊)、TRC‑20(TRON)、BEP‑20(BSC)、OMNI(比特币链)、Solana、Polygon、Avalanche、Arbitrum、Optimism等)。IM钱包必须明确支持的链并能识别对应的代币合约地址/代币ID。
2. 合约校验:钱包应提供合约地址显示、合约源码或官方验证链接、代币符号与精度(decimals)校验,避免加入伪造代币。对ERC‑20类代币需显示token contract;对非账户模型链(如OMNI)需显示协议标识。
3. 代币添加与升级:支持用户自定义添加自定义代币合约地址,并提示风险;对升级合约或代币重命名,需要做好兼容与用户公告。
4. 合约交互权限:若钱包支持智能合约调用(授权、转账、合约交换),需提示并限制授权额度,支持撤销授权操作并记录交易审计信息。
二、交易流程(充值与提现的端到端流程)
1. 充值(入金)流程:
- 选择链与代币:用户在IM钱包选择USDT并确认链(例如TRC‑20或ERC‑20)。
- 获取收款地址:钱包显示目标链地址,若需Tag/Memo(多数USDT不需要,但某些平台会要求),必须显式提示。对跨链或托管场景,显示完整充值说明。
- 小额测试:首次充值建议先发小额试验(例如0.1 USDT或少量),确认到账后再转大额。
- 链上确认:根据链的确认规则等待区块确认(TRON通常1–2个区块即到账,ETH需要多 confirmations)。钱包应显示实时上链状态与确认数。
- 记账与通知:内部系统需把链上交易hash映射到用户账户,完成会计入账并通知用户。
2. 提现(出金)流程:
- 提交提现请求:用户填写目标地址、选择链与手续费策略(慢/普通/快)。

- 风控与合规检查:地址白名单、最大频率、KYC/AML策略与限额校验。
- 签名与广播:对非托管钱包,客户端签名后广播;托管则由后端处理批量签名与广播。
- 完成与对账:广播后监控上链并在达成所需确认后标记成功,发出到账通知。
3. 常见注意事项:
- 链不匹配风险:若用户把ERC‑20 USDT发到TRC‑20地址,资金可能丢失。务必提示用户确认链。
- 费用与Gas:ERC‑20转账需ETH做gas;TRC‑20需TRX做能量,钱包应提示并支持代付或提醒充值相应燃料。
三、比特现金(BCH)支持要点
1. 地址格式:BCH常见有CashAddr格式与Legacy格式,钱包需支持两者并在界面上标注,避免用户混淆。
2. UTXO模型:BCH与BTC类似是UTXO模型,处理时需构建输入输出并处理找零(change),注意避免产生大量尘土输出。
3. 费用与确认:设置合理费率(以byte计费),并可根据内存池动态调节。对于大额出金建议设置更高优先级。
4. 交易签名与分支:支持链分叉和重放保护策略,确保签名算法兼容并在必要时对串行化差异进行处理。
5. 对账与索引:建立UTXO索引器,用于快速查找入账交易并实现自动对账。
四、高效资金管理(策略与实践)
1. 热/冷钱包分层:
- 冷钱包(离线存储)保存大部分资产(多签或硬件),定期人工或自动化审查并仅在必要时调拨热钱包资金。
- 热钱包负责日常收付,保留合理流水备付量并采用多签或HSM保护私钥。
2. 资金池与内部账本:对外链上仅保留必要出入金,内部使用账本系统进行“站内”转账(即时更新用户余额),减少链上交易次数与手续费。
3. 批量与合并策略:提现打包与批量合并UTXO(对UTXO链)或ERC‑20代币批量转账,减少交易费用并提高处理效率。
4. 手续费优化:自动根据网络拥堵与费用模型(如EIP‑1559)调整出金费率,支持手续费预测与用户自选优先级。
5. 资金监控与异常报警:实时监控余额、异常提现模式、频繁的失败转账、链上大额流出,结合风控规则触发人工复核。
五、高效资金处理(技术实现与自动化)
1. 并行化处理:使用异步队列(RabbitMQ/Kafka)与并发工作器并发广播与交易状态监控,提升吞吐量。
2. 交易重试与替换:对于未入池或卡在mempool的交易实现优雅重发或使用replace‑by‑fee(若支持)提高成功率。
3. 上链确认策略:不同业务场景采用不同确认门槛(如快速小额1–2 confirmations,大额≥12 confirmations),并将确认状态映射到业务流程中。
4. 对接节点与第三方服务:同时连接自建完整节点与备份第三方节点/服务(如区块浏览器API),保证高可用性与快速回退。
5. 自动对账与流水同步:链上交易入账后自动匹配内部流水并生成异常报告,支持人工复核与自动纠错。
六、加密存储(密钥管理与备份)
1. 私钥与助记词保护:
- 强烈建议使用硬件钱包(HSM/安全芯片)或多签策略存放私钥。
- 助记词必须脱机备份,使用加密纸质或金属备份,并严格控制访问权限。
2. 多签与门限签名:采用多签(例如2/3、M-of-N)或门限签名(Shamir/Thss),降低单点故障与内部盗用风险。
3. HSM与企业级密钥管理:对企业托管资金,使用经过审计的HSM与专用KMS,并保持操作审计日志与访问控制。
4. 备份与演练:定期进行恢复演练,确保备份有效并能在人员变动或事故发生时迅速恢复。
5. 数据加密与权限管理:对私钥和敏感配置进行加密存储(静态加密),并严格分离开发/运维权限与审计追踪。
七、行业预测与建议
1. 多链与跨链成为常态:USDT及其他稳定币将继续多链分发,钱包需支持更多链并提供清晰的链选择与风险提示。跨链桥与跨链流动性工具会进一步成熟,但伴随安全挑战。
2. 监管与合规趋严:全球对稳定币与交易平台监管加强,合规(KYC/AML、可审计账本)成为市场准入门槛,托管服务将更倾向合规化与托管保险。
3. 技术演进促成本费用优化:Layer‑2、侧链及更低费用链(TRON、BSC、Solana等)会继续承载大量稳定币转账,钱包应支持多链费用智能选择。

4. 安全与加密存储投资增加:由于资金安全事件频发,企业会投入更多在多签、HSM、自动化审计及应急响应。
5. 用户体验成为关键:简化链选择、自动提示所需燃料(Gas/TRX/ETH)、钱包间极速兑换(内置桥或DEX聚合)将提升用户转化率。
八、操作与安全建议(给用户与运营者的实用提示)
- 充值前先核对链与地址,首次先小额试充。
- 对ERC‑20 USDT,确保钱包有足够ETH作为gas。对TRC‑20确保TRX余额或使用代付服务。
- 不要在不明网站粘贴助记词,不要对未知合约随意授权。
- 企业运营方应实施冷热分离、多签、HSM、自动化对账与合规监控。
结语:
在IM钱包中充值USDT并支持BCH,需要兼顾多链合约兼容性、严谨的交易流程、健全的资金管理与高效处理机制以及可靠的加密存储方案。随着行业发展,合规与多链能力将是钱包产品的核心竞争力。无论个人用户还是托管服务方,都应把安全放在首位,结合自动化与人工审计来实现既高效又可控的资金运营。